Engaging and Retaining Members

To maintain a vibrant community, it is essential to offer valuable content and targeted promotions to your members. Regularly sharing engaging and relevant content can help keep your group active and interesting. Additionally, interacting with your members, asking them questions, and seeking their input can foster a sense of belonging and engagement.

If you have some of your most dedicated members, consider asking for their help in growing the group. Their enthusiasm and support can be a powerful tool in attracting new members. Setting clear rules and guidelines for the group can also ensure that members understand what to expect and how to conduct themselves.

Utilize the Invite Feature

Faithfully, Facebook provides an inviting feature that allows you to invite people to join your group. You should leverage this feature by inviting your friends and their friends to join. Be sure to communicate clearly about the purpose and benefits of your group before inviting them. Encouraging your members to also invite others will exponentially increase your group's membership base.

Another effective strategy is to create content that highlights the value of your group. Share links to your group with Facebook users who would be interested in joining. A strong theme for your content and consistency in posting can also attract and retain members.
